Account Recovery — Canary Gating (Plugin Authors). Recovery flows on Brindlewick deploy behind a 5% canary. Your plugin must pass the Hollowgate conformance suite before the canary widens; failures auto-rollback within two minutes. Do not retry recovery calls during a rollback window. To validate against the staging tenant, authenticate with the passphrase below.

unlock words, fadug-tageg: zorix-wenwyn-quenmir

### v3.2.0 — Renamed setting

Keyspindle no longer reads `KS_ROTATE_TOKEN`; it was renamed for consistency with the plugin API. Plugins targeting 3.2+ must use the new name or rotation hooks will not fire. The old name is ignored silently — no deprecation warning is emitted. Update your `.env` before upgrading. Keep `KS_PLUGIN_DIR` and `KS_LOG_LEVEL` as-is. Immediately after those entries, add the renamed token line with your existing value.

secret setting of kawif-kajef: COURIER_KEY3=d2b

### Runbook: BounceBroom — Account Recovery

If the BounceBroom email bounce processor loses access to its service account, do not create a new one. First, pause the intake queue so bounces buffer safely. Then open the recovery console and select the BounceBroom principal. Verification requires approval from the on-call lead. Once approved, the console prompts for the stored recovery credentials; enter the passphrase that appears directly below this paragraph.

recovery phrase for fahof-kahap: holion-gormir-jorix-istix-briwyn-sorael